Over the past centuries practical visionaries from the [[Franciscan]] monks who founded the community-oriented [[pawnshops]] of the fifteenth century, to the founders of the European [[credit union]] movement in the nineteenth century (such as [[Friedrich Wilhelm Raiffeisen]]) and the founders of the [[microcredit]] movement in the 1970s (such as [[Muhammad Yunus]]) have tested practices and built institutions designed to bring the kinds of livelihood opportunities and risk management tools that financial services provide to the doorsteps of poor people. While the success of [[Grameen Bank]] (which now serves over seven million poor Bangladeshi women) has inspired the world, it has proved difficult to replicate this success in practice. In nations with lower population densities, meeting the operating costs of a retail branch by serving nearby customers has proven considerably more challenging.

Although much progress has been made, the problem has not been solved yet, and the overwhelming majority of people who earn less than $1 a day, especially in the rural areas, continue to have no practical access to [[formal]] sector finance. Microfinance has been growing rapidly with $25B currently at work in microfinance loans.  It is estimated that the industry needs $250 billion to get capital to all the poor people who need it.  The industry has been growing rapidly and there have been concerns that the rate of capital flowing into microfinance is a potential risk unless managed well.[https://www.citigroup.com/citigroup/microfinance/data/news080303b.pdf][https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Microfinance]
